Golubev (Russian: Голубев; masculine) or Golubeva (Го́лубева; feminine) is a Russian last name, derived from the Russian word голубь (golub, "pigeon"). It may refer to:

  • Aleksandr Golubev (footballer) (b. 1986), Russian association football player
  • Aleksandr Golubev (speed skater) (b. 1972), Russian speed skater
  • Andrey Golubev (b. 1987), Kazakh tennis player
  • Dmitry Golubev (disambiguation), several people
  • Evgeny Golubev (1910–1988), Russian composer
  • Georgy Golubev [ru] (1919–2005), Soviet army officer and Hero of the Soviet Union
  • Ivan Golubev (1841–1918), Russian politician
  • Ivan Andreevich Golubev, Russian name of Wang Ming, an early Communist Party of China leader and 28 Bolsheviks member
  • Kirill Golubev (b. 1974), Soviet and Russian ice hockey player
  • Konstantin Golubev (1896 – 1956), Soviet general and army commander during World War II
  • Sergey Golubev (officer) (1923–?), Soviet army officer, Hero of the Soviet Union and consultant on the assassination of Georgy Markov
  • Sergey Golubev (b. 1978), Russian bobsledder
  • Valery Golubev (b. 1952), Russian politician and businessman
  • Vasily Golubev (painter) (1925–1985), Soviet, Russian painter
  • Vasily Golubev (politician) (born 1957), governor of Rostov Oblast, Russia
  • Viktor Golubev (1916–1945), Soviet aircraft pilot and twice Hero of the Soviet Union
  • Vladimir Golubev (mathematician) [de] (1884–1954), Soviet mathematician and mechanic
  • Vladimir Golubev (footballer) (1950–2022), Soviet association football player and coach
